Are you an ambitious Amazon professional looking to move in-house and take ownership of marketplace growth for household-name brands?

We are partnering with a highly established, global health and beauty brand to hire an eCommerce Specialist. With a strong presence across Amazon and ambitious plans for further expansion, they are seeking an Amazon expert to take ownership of account performance and drive commercial growth.

The Opportunity

This is an excellent opportunity for someone with hands-on Amazon experience who wants to combine commercial strategy with day-to-day marketplace execution.

A major selling point of this role is the international scope and true autonomy. You will take full operational and commercial ownership of the UK and global markets, working directly with the EMEA eCommerce Lead.

This is a rare chance to step away from juggling dozens of agency clients and instead focus deeply on scaling a dedicated portfolio of industry-leading products within a fast-paced, entrepreneurial environment.

What You'll Be Doing

  • Managing and optimizing Amazon Vendor Central operations (alongside Seller Central) to ensure digital shelf excellence
  • Driving revenue growth through marketplace optimization and commercial strategy
  • Monitoring account performance and identifying daily opportunities for improvement
  • Optimizing product listings, content, catalog performance, and variations
  • Supporting Amazon advertising activity (AVS, SAS) alongside internal teams and external agencies
  • Monitoring account health, inventory performance, and operational metrics
  • Analyzing marketplace data to provide actionable recommendations
  • Coordinating new product launches and assortment management across your designated regions

What We're Looking For

Essential

  • Minimum 3-5 years of experience in e-commerce, preferably managing Amazon accounts
  • Hands-on experience with Amazon Vendor Central and/or Seller Central
  • A Bachelor’s degree in Economics, Marketing, Business Administration, or a related field
  • Commercially minded with strong analytical skills and PC proficiency (PowerBI is a plus!)
  • Excellent English communication and stakeholder management abilities
  • A self-starter who is comfortable working collaboratively within a fast-paced environment

Desirable

  • Previous experience in the FMCG, health, or beauty sectors
  • Experience operating across international marketplaces

Why Join & What's On Offer

  • Competitive Salary: £50,000 - £65,000
  • Location: Greater London (2dpw in office)
  • In-House Move: Opportunity to join a well-established, globally recognized consumer brand
  • Significant Ownership: Autonomy to drive the strategy for the UK and global markets
  • Collaborative Culture: A supportive working environment with cross-functional international teams
  • Progression: Clear opportunities for professional development as the business continues to invest heavily in its Amazon channels
